VICTOR S. FROST Curriculum Vitae

August 8, 2019 Personal Information

Dan F. Servey Distinguished Professor Electrical Engineering & Computer Science University of Kansas 1520 West 15th Street 2054 Eaton Hall Lawrence, KS 66045 Web Address: http://www.ittc.ku.edu/~frost Email Address: [email protected] Office Phone: (785) 864-1028 Office Fax: (785) 864-7789

Education

Ph.D.E.E., Honors, 1982

University of Kansas M.S.E.E., Honors, 1978

University of Kansas B.S.E.E., 1977

University of Kansas Employment History

Academic

University of Kansas

Dan F. Servey Distinguished Professor, EECS, 1997 – Present Chair, Electrical Engineering and Computer Science, July 1, 2014 – June 30, 2019 Associate Chair for Graduate Studies, Electrical Engineering and Computer Science Department, 2011 - July 1, 2014 Director, Information and Telecommunications Technology Center, 2000 - 2008

ITTC was one of the largest research centers at the University of Kansas, with approximately 150 faculty, staff, and students, and external expenditures averaging $5.4 Million/year from FY1998-FY2007.

Acting Director, Information and Telecommunications Technology Center, 1997 - 1999 Executive Director for Research, Information and Telecommunications Technology Center, 1996 - 1997 Professor, Electrical Engineering and Computer Science Department, 1992 - 1997 Director, Telecommunications and Information Sciences Laboratory (TISL), 1987 - 1996 Associate Professor, Electrical and Computer Engineering Department, 1986 - 1992 Associate Director, Telecommunications and Information Sciences Laboratory (TISL), 1986 - 1987 Assistant Professor, Electrical Engineering Department, 1982 - 1986

Project Engineer, University of Kansas Remote Sensing Laboratory, 1978 - 1982 Responsibilities included proposal preparation, direction of graduate and undergraduate research assistants, and reporting to contracting agencies. The research was aimed at determining the stochastic nature of radar images, evaluating the quality of such images, and developing digital processing techniques for radar data, e.g., enhancement and edge detection.

Research Engineer, University of Kansas Remote Sensing Laboratory, 1976 - 1978 Conducted research in the areas of radar image simulation and system modeling.

Professional

National Science Foundation in CISE/CNS

Program Director, February 2009 - February 2011 United States Air Force, Rome Air Development Center, Communications Division, Rome, NY

Summer Faculty Fellow, Summer 1983 Research related to the analysis and simulation of spread-spectrum communication systems in jamming and intercept environments.

ST*AR Corporation

President, 1979 - 1981 Duties included proposal preparation, supervision of employees, negotiating with contracting agencies, and budgeting.

Research

AT&T Information Systems Laboratory, Denver, CO

Resident visiting member of the technical staff, Summer 1985 Performed simulation and measurement studies of local area networks.

German Aerospace Research Establishment (DFVLR) Institute for High Frequency, Oberpfaffenhofen, West Germany

Visiting Scientist, July 1981 - December 1981 Participated in an International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) experiment. Performed an information theory analysis of SAR images. Developed and implemented image processing algorithms for SAR imagery.
